public class ServiceSettings
extends java.lang.Object
限定符和类型 | 字段和说明 |
---|---|
static java.lang.String |
CHINESE
中文
|
static java.lang.String |
ENGLISH
英文
|
static int |
HTTP
Http协议。
|
static int |
HTTPS
Https协议。
|
限定符和类型 | 方法和说明 |
---|---|
int |
getConnectionTimeOut()
返回搜索服务建立连接超时限制。
|
static ServiceSettings |
getInstance()
初始化ServiceSettings的单例对象。
|
java.lang.String |
getLanguage()
搜索、地理/逆地理编码、输入提示的返回结果语言类型,中英文。
|
int |
getProtocol()
返回访问使用的协议类别
|
int |
getSoTimeOut()
读取返回结果超时限制
|
void |
setApiKey(java.lang.String apiKey)
动态设置apiKey。
|
void |
setConnectionTimeOut(int connectionTimeout)
设置搜索服务建立连接超时。
|
void |
setLanguage(java.lang.String language)
设置搜索、地理/逆地理编码、输入提示中英文切换的接口。
|
void |
setProtocol(int protocol)
设置访问使用的协议类别。
|
void |
setSoTimeOut(int soTimeOut)
设置搜索读取返回结果超时。
|
static void |
updatePrivacyAgree(Context context,
boolean isAgree)
更新同意隐私状态,需要在初始化地图之前完成
|
static void |
updatePrivacyShow(Context context,
boolean isContains,
boolean isShow)
更新隐私合规状态,需要在初始化地图之前完成
|
public static final java.lang.String ENGLISH
ServiceSettings.setLanguage(String)
,
常量字段值public static final java.lang.String CHINESE
ServiceSettings.setLanguage(String)
,
常量字段值public static final int HTTP
public static final int HTTPS
public int getConnectionTimeOut()
public int getSoTimeOut()
public void setConnectionTimeOut(int connectionTimeout)
connectionTimeout
- 毫秒级参数。public void setSoTimeOut(int soTimeOut)
soTimeOut
- 毫秒级参数。public static ServiceSettings getInstance()
public void setLanguage(java.lang.String language)
language
- 语言类型 ServiceSettings.ENGLISH
或者 ServiceSettings.CHINESE
。public void setProtocol(int protocol)
protocol
- 包含Http和Https两种协议。public java.lang.String getLanguage()
public int getProtocol()
public void setApiKey(java.lang.String apiKey)
apiKey
- 在高德官网上申请的apiKey。public static void updatePrivacyShow(Context context, boolean isContains, boolean isShow)
context:
- 上下文isContains:
- 隐私权政策是否包含高德开平隐私权政策 true是包含isShow: 隐私权政策是否弹窗展示告知用户 true是展示
- public static void updatePrivacyAgree(Context context, boolean isAgree)
context:
- 上下文isAgree:
- 隐私权政策是否取得用户同意 true是用户同意